Transaction 24998fabbd3b72f7924b9599c397fc4e70fb7eafbfae0c5d36404c13fa380aa9

1 Input
2 Outputs
  • 24998fabbd3b72f7924b9599c397fc4e70fb7eafbfae0c5d36404c13fa380aa9:0
  • value  89690967
    address  1BCnEWCBwKKqX7DxPgMJWdoD6hxDAkem78
  • 24998fabbd3b72f7924b9599c397fc4e70fb7eafbfae0c5d36404c13fa380aa9:1
  • value  15297365
    address  1HnWVGm1pWxQtCLnAtWzNHM5kLhSPqNh7M